#94c88b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#94c88b is composed of 58% red, 78.4%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 111.1 degrees, a saturation of 35.7% and a lightness of 66.5%. #94c88b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#299117.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#94c88b color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.

#94c88b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#94c88b has RGB values of R:148, G:200,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 9750667.

Hex triplet 94c88b #94c88b
RGB Decimal 148, 200, 139 rgb(148,200,139)
RGB Percent 58, 78.4, 54.5 rgb(58%,78.4%,54.5%)
CMYK 26, 0, 31, 22
HSL 111.1°, 35.7, 66.5 hsl(111.1,35.7%,66.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 111.1°, 30.5, 78.4
Web Safe 99cc99 #99cc99
CIE-LAB 75.741, -28.632, 25.208
XYZ 37.526, 49.467, 31.996
xyY 0.315, 0.416, 49.467
CIE-LCH 75.741, 38.148, 138.639
CIE-LUV 75.741, -25.99, 39.55
Hunter-Lab 70.333, -27.845, 22.261
Binary 10010100, 11001000, 10001011

Shades and Tints of #94c88b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020402 is the darkest color, while #f6faf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#94c88b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7aea5 is the less saturated color, while #6ffd56 is the most saturated one.
